The Ahipoutu Collective Charitable Trust is a Trust charity in the Health sector, based in Tauranga, Tauranga. This organisation also provides funding to other charities.
Mission: The Ahipoutu Collective exists to empower rangatahi, whānau, and our local communities through the revitalisation, practice, and innovation of toi Māori. Our purpose is to uphold and advance mātauranga Māori by weaving traditional and contemporary artforms—such as tā moko, whakairo, and pūrakau—into everyday life, supporting cultural identity, wellbeing, and intergenerational connection.
